Hello guys ,I started to make this car faster and reliable . So i decided to share with you my ideas and the progress. Last time the car was in the track was like it said in my signature.
Now i decided to make the car faster in a low budget. First thing i decided was to make it lighter.The Camaro is a factory stripper no power accessories of any kind. When it ran 12.75 was at 3320 pounds without me in, with 1/4 tank of gas. Still have AC and stereo;
Now in this round i installed a 25% UD pulley , BMR turbo K member , Performabuild Transmission with 4K yank, a UMI tunnel mount TA and a XS Power mini battery.
My expectation is to loose 30lbs in k member, the UMI TA weight 32.2 and the factory TA was 17 lbs so at this point i loose 15lbs net in this move. Now the stall full of ATF is like 15lbs difference and the battery my optima red top is 30.0lbs the XS Power is 14.7lbs. In the stall i think i loose like 10 to 15lbs. I loose like 45lbs in weight not counting rotating mass.
I hope to gain like .5 to .7 of a second in the 1/4 if the car hook well.

I was running 12.89 with Kooks headers and duals, slp cai, and tune. Stock stall and 2.73s.
I put in a performabuilt lvl 2 4L60, FTI 4,000 stall, bmr chromoly torque arm, & et streets on the stock rims and went 12.29. So shaving .7 off your et is certainly doable.
You will need to have your shift points retuned. Mine would hit the rev limiter before shifting after I put the stall in, but a good tuner can fix this in a few minutes.
And the the key is traction. Make sure you have a good drag radial or you'll be disappointed.

Thanks for the help with the trans calibration.Is working like a champ. Next weekend I going to install F/R MWC bumper supports , rear double adj. Vikings ,solid adj. MWC lca and carpet delete to test it Saturday.
Yes I expected some more from the verter too, is a lot to keep fine tunning. I re calibrated the transmission and play with some base timing and fuel. But with a Dyno tune is a lot easier to find the tune that maximize the combo. Another factor that play a big role in my car is I'm 4000' above sea lever and for a NA motor is less oxygen.
